Cu Chi Tunnels Experience

HCMC Private Tour: Cu Chi and Mekong Delta in 1 Day - Cu Chi Tunnels Experience

Exploring the Cu Chi Tunnels offers a fascinating glimpse into Vietnam’s wartime history, showcasing the incredible ingenuity of those who lived and fought underground. Visitors can wander through over 250 kilometers of these historically significant tunnels, experiencing firsthand the cramped conditions that Viet Cong soldiers endured.

The tour includes a documentary that provides context about the conflict, enriching the experience. Adventurous guests can even crawl through narrow, hand-dug passages, feeling the weight of history around them.

To further enjoy the wartime atmosphere, they can sample boiled tapioca served with hot pandan tea. For those seeking an adrenaline rush, there’s an optional shooting experience with AK47 or MK16 rifles available for an additional fee, adding a thrilling twist to the journey.

Cultural Insights

Experience the vibrant culture of Vietnam as travelers engage with local sellers at bustling wet markets, gaining insight into the daily lives of countryside residents. These interactions foster authentic cultural exchanges, allowing participants to appreciate the rich traditions and culinary delights of the region.

Cultural Aspect Description
Local Markets Explore fresh produce and handmade goods while chatting with vendors.
Folk Music Enjoy ‘Don ca tai tu,’ a traditional music genre recognized by UNESCO.
Culinary Traditions Savor authentic dishes like deep-fried giant gourami and tropical fruits.

What Is the Best Time of Year for This Tour?

The best time for this tour is from November to April. During these months, the weather’s drier and cooler, making outdoor activities enjoyable. Travelers appreciate comfortable temperatures while exploring the beautiful landscapes and local culture.
